Trap me in your love novel Chapter 259

Since the last time he saw Jessie, Lawrence had never seen her, not even asking her a question.

In fact, it was not that he didn't want to, but that he dare not.

When he was shot and hurt, he really hated her to the bone, but in the moment when she appeared, all the hatred disappeared.

In the face of this relationship, he knew that he was passive and humble, so he could no longer let himself be.

Even if the missing tortured him, Lawrence had to grit his teeth and hold it back.

Only when they both had enough space to calm down and think could they clearly know how good he was to her!

Knock...

"Sir, I have cooked crucian soup for you. It's good for your wound. You must drink more."

Lawrence looked at Aria, who was standing by the bed, with a smile on her face and gently scooping Soup for him. He couldn't help but think, 'if only this is Jasmine.' Then he asked, "how's Jasmine doing these days?"

Her hand holding the bowl trembled slightly, and the hot soup spilled on the back of her hand, instantly turning red.

Aria pretended to be calm and said, "it's good. She eat well and sleep well."

"Really? "He looked at her suspiciously. When he saw that Aria nodded her head, a touch of disappointment and sadness instantly blurred his eyes.

Didn't Jasmine miss him?

Even if it was just a little bit?

Lawrence didn't believe it, but he couldn't find a reason to doubt it.

After all, Jasmine had said more than once that she wanted to be free and leave him. Without him by her side, Jasmine should be very leisurely.

It was normal that Jasmine didn't miss him.

"Sir, have some soup first. It has been cooked for hours." Aria handed the soup to him, and then Lawrence took it and drank it casually, completely unaware of the taste.

"Sir, with all due respect, I don't think Miss Jasmine cares about you at all. Look at you lying here because of her. She doesn't care about you at all. Do you think it's worth doing this for her?"

"Is it worth it?" Aria asked. Lawrence lowered his eyes, bitterness spreading in his heart. "What's the meaning of life if we have to care about whether it's worth it or not and whether it's worth it or not?"

"But it's meaningless if you only pay for it without any return. What you have done is worth it in your own eyes. You are willing to do it, but in others' eyes, you are just a contemptible scoundrel. "

"What about you?" Lawrence fixed his eyes on Aria and said, "Haven't you always been doing this for me and never cared about return?"

"……"

Aria was stunned for a while, and a burst of bitterness surged up in her heart.

"I don't care about the reward, because you gave me my life. No matter whether my love for you can be completed or not, I will always be yours. Even if you don't care about it. "

"In fact, you don't have to do that, Aria." Lawrence was helpless and embarrassed. Back then, he saved her not for any special reason. When he saw her lying in the jungle at her last gasp, like an abandoned animal, he felt pity for her.

"I didn't have any reason to save you at the beginning. I kept you by my side only is that you need a stable residence, and I just need a talent like you. I have no other meaning."

"I know you don't, but people all have feelings. Even if we are not in love, there will be family affection, the love of master and slave between us. Am I right to be loyal to my master? "
